Meme coins are cryptocurrencies that gain traction and value mainly through social media hype and community support. Icons like Dogecoin and Shiba Inu lead the pack. Their worth often hinges more on community engagement than on robust technological foundations.

Trader sentiment plays a pivotal role in the success of meme coins. Prices often reflect market excitement, with spikes following viral trends. For instance, case studies of coins like WIF reveal that savvy marketing can lead to astonishing price increases—like a jaw-dropping 340% surge in just days.
